Flames lapping the edges of an Indian brick kiln, the concrete beams of Herzog De Meuron’s Beijing Olympic stadium, and a Gothic doorway in Milan’s Doumo are   among   the   images shortlisted for   this year’s Art of Building Photographer of the Year competition (+ slideshow). The name of the winner, who will be awarded a £3,000 cash prize, will be announced on 5 February.
